The Soundking BB812-4/3m is a professional-grade XLR microphone cable designed for reliable audio signal transmission in live sound, studio, and broadcasting applications.

Key Features:
-
Connector Type: Male XLR to Female XLR
-
Length: 3 meters
-
High-Quality Construction: Ensures clear and noise-free sound transmission
-
Durable Design: Built to withstand the rigors of professional use
This cable is ideal for musicians, audio engineers, and broadcasters seeking a dependable connection for microphones and other XLR-compatible devices.
